Resumen:
The catalytic decomposition of methane (CDM) is an attractive alternative for the production of COx-free hydrogen for use in fuel cells. Numerous supported metal catalysts have been tested for this process. Among them, Ni, Co and noble metals can catalyze the decomposition of methane forming carbon nanofibers under relative mild conditions. However, these catalysts rapidly deactivate [1-2]. Thus, in order to stabilize the active metal, lanthana alone or combined with silica is used in this work.
